5. A single visa for your whole study plan 

Most international students are required to apply for 2 visas – 1 for their pathway and 1 for their degree. But there’s another option that will save you time and money. 

At some of our centers, we offer International Foundation programs that are already combined with an undergraduate degree through iCAS*. With this continuous study plan, you’ll avoid the hassle and the extra costs of visa renewal in between your studies. One visa, one study plan, no fuss.

Is the International Foundation right for you? 

The International Foundation program is suitable for students who: 

  • are at least 16 years old 
  • have an IELTS result of 4.5 in all sub-skills, depending on the course and term length (many INTO centers offer a supporting Academic English course if you don’t meet this requirement). 
  • can submit a portfolio depending on the program or if required by the center, which will give admissions officers a deeper understanding of your abilities.

* Integrated Confirmation of Acceptance for Studies (iCAS) is a program combining undergraduate degree with a pathway program, enabling international students to study in the UK with a single visa from pathway to university. Other conditions may include criteria such as retaining your status as a non-UK or EU student.
